抄録

A long life three phase flywheel (FW) uninterruptible power supply (UPS) using an electrolytic capacitor-less converter/inverter and a transformer-less isolating system rating of 200V and 5kW-1min is described. The UPS has following characteristics. (1) Electrolytic capacitor-less converter/inverter configuration which makes long life and small size. (2) Transformer-less isolating system to realize small size and right weight. (3) Battery less system for maintenance free and long life about 20 years. The electrolytic capacitor-less converter/inverter has a small film capacitor value of 1/50 times of a conventional ones. The converter/inverter is controlled by a current and voltage follow-up method using PWM control. Charging and discharging abilities of the FW energy is achieved only by controlling the instantaneous slip frequency of the induction machine. The UPS has excellence test results which are obtained such as input power factor of 99.8%, small output voltage distortion of 1.03% and 93.8% efficiency at full load.
